ホームページ  >  記事  >  バックエンド開発  >  PHP マイクロフレームワーク: Slim と Phalcon のメンテナンスと更新戦略

PHP マイクロフレームワーク: Slim と Phalcon のメンテナンスと更新戦略

WBOY
WBOYオリジナル
2024-06-02 11:42:58201ブラウズ

Slim および Phalcon のメンテナンスおよび更新戦略: Slim: 安定版リリース、長期サポート (LTS) リリース、および GitHub プル リクエストを介したコミュニティへの貢献を提供します。 Phalcon: 商用サポート、コミュニティへの貢献、バグ修正、機能強化、パフォーマンス向上などの定期的なアップデートを提供します。

PHP微框架:Slim 和 Phalcon 的维护和更新策略

PHP マイクロフレームワーク: Slim と Phalcon のメンテナンスと更新戦略

マイクロフレームワークは、軽量で効率的な PHP アプリケーションを構築する上で重要な役割を果たします。マイクロフレームワークの世界では、Slim と Phalcon は高速なパフォーマンスとシンプルさで知られています。マイクロフレームワークを選択するときは、そのメンテナンスと更新の戦略を理解することが重要です。

Slim のメンテナンス戦略

Slim は、シンプルさと拡張性を重視した軽量のマイクロフレームワークです。そのメンテナンス戦略は主に以下に焦点を当てています:

  • 安定版: Slim はバグ修正とセキュリティ更新を提供するために安定版を定期的にリリースします。
  • 長期サポート (LTS) バージョン: Slim は 3 年ごとに LTS バージョンをリリースし、より長いサポートとメンテナンス サイクルを提供します。 LTS バージョンには、新機能と古い PHP バージョンのサポートが含まれています。
  • プル リクエスト: Slim は主に GitHub のプル リクエストを通じて維持されます。コミュニティの貢献者はバグ修正や機能拡張リクエストを送信でき、コア チームによってレビューされ、統合されます。

Phalcon のメンテナンス戦略

Phalcon は、より完全なツールセットを提供するフルスタック フレームワークです。そのメンテナンス戦略は次の側面に焦点を当てています:

  • 商用サポート: Phalcon は、フレームワーク自体を保守する会社によって提供される商用サポートを提供します。商用サポートには通常、優先的なバグ修正、セキュリティ更新プログラム、およびテクニカル サポートが含まれます。
  • コミュニティへの貢献: Slim と同様に、Phalcon にも、GitHub のプル リクエストを通じて貢献するアクティブなコミュニティがあります。
  • 定期的なアップデート: Phalcon は、バグ修正、機能強化、パフォーマンスの向上を含む新しいバージョンを定期的にリリースします。

実践的なケース

これらの戦略を使用して Slim および Phalcon アプリケーションを管理および更新する方法を見てみましょう:

Slim の動作

  1. Composer から Slim をインストールします: composer require Slim/slim composer require slim/slim
  2. 更新到最新稳定版本:composer update
  3. 在 LTS 版本中锁定依赖项:使用 Composer 的 --prefer-stable 标志来确保使用 LTS 版本。

Phalcon 实战

  1. 购买商业支持:从 Phalcon 网站购买支持计划。
  2. 安装 Phalcon:composer require phalcon/phalcon
  3. 更新到最新版本:使用 Phalcon 的 phalcon update
  4. 最新の安定バージョンに更新します: composer update
LTS リリースの依存関係をロックします:

Composer の --prefer-stable フラグを使用して、LTS バージョンを確実に使用します。

Phalcon の動作🎜🎜🎜🎜商用サポートを購入する: 🎜Phalcon Web サイトからサポート プランを購入します。 🎜🎜🎜Phalcon をインストールします: 🎜composer require palcon/palcon 🎜🎜🎜最新バージョンに更新します: 🎜Phalcon の palcon update コマンドを使用します。 🎜🎜🎜実稼働環境での使用: 🎜Phalcon は、実際の環境へのデプロイメントに使用できる実稼働品質のコードを提供します。 🎜🎜🎜🎜注: 🎜特定のメンテナンスおよび更新戦略は時間の経過とともに変更される可能性があるため、最新情報についてはマイクロフレームワークの公式ドキュメントを参照することをお勧めします。 🎜

以上がPHP マイクロフレームワーク: Slim と Phalcon のメンテナンスと更新戦略の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。